';const darkTheme="dark"===new URLSearchParams(window.location.search.toLowerCase()).get("theme");darkTheme&&(loader.globalAreaTag.style.background="#121416",loader.loadMessageTag.style.background="#121416"),loader.initialize(),loader.show();const DOMAIN_REPLACE_VARIABLE="%current_domain%",currentDomain=window.location.hostname.replace("www.",""),handleUrlVariable=e=>e.replace("%current_domain%",currentDomain),replaceSettingVar=e=>({...e,common:(e.common||[]).map((e=>handleUrlVariable(e))),commonQueues:(e.commonQueues||[]).map((e=>e.map((e=>handleUrlVariable(e))))),line:(e.line||[]).map((e=>handleUrlVariable(e))),lineQueues:(e.lineQueues||[]).map((e=>e.map((e=>handleUrlVariable(e))))),line_rendertron:(e.line_rendertron||[]).map((e=>handleUrlVariable(e))),static:handleUrlVariable(e.static),mapOfAdditionalOriginURIs:Object.keys(e.mapOfAdditionalOriginURIs||{}).reduce(((a,r)=>{const t=e.mapOfAdditionalOriginURIs[r];return a[r]=handleUrlVariable(t),a}),{})}),initSettings=e=>{const a=replaceSettingVar(e);if(window._buildInfo=a,renderScript.isRendertron&&a){const e=(a.line_rendertron||[])[0]||(a.line||[])[0];renderScript.runWindowLoadDelay(e)}},urlsPreloadRaw='{ "common": [ "//clientsapi03.fb2834-resources.com", "//clientsapi21.fb2834-resources.com" ], "line": [ "//line03.fb2834-resources.com", "//line21.fb2834-resources.com" ], "static": "//origin-r2.fb2834-resources.com", "commonApi": "//fastviewdata.fb2834-resources.com", "staticSiteDir": "/webStaticFB/website", "mapOfAdditionalOriginURIs": {}, "updateUtcDate": "Tue, 18 Mar 2025 07:52:23 GMT", "site": { "version": "1.49.76", "forceUpdateVersion": 0, "environment": "production", "ref": "bWFzdGVy", "configHash": "817206a383712bdfa98a9d4d7a3347ab" }, "enableClickStream": true, "defaultFracSize": 2, "betRoundAccuracy": 0.01}';if(urlsPreloadRaw){const e=JSON.parse(urlsPreloadRaw);initSettings(e),appLoad.loadBootstrap(!1)}else{renderScript.isRendertron&&console.log("render: load script wont work!");const e=renderScript.isRendertron?6e5*Math.trunc(Date.now()/6e5):Date.now();fetch(`/urls.json?hash=${e}`).then((e=>e.json())).then((e=>{initSettings(e),appLoad.loadBootstrap(!1)})).catch((()=>{appLoad&&!appLoad.restartTimer&&(appLoad.restartTimer=setTimeout((()=>{appLoad.restartTimer=void 0,appLoad.restart()}),appLoad.restartTimeout),loader.printMsg(appLoad.newLine(appLoad.msgDownloadFailed)+appLoad.newLine(`The application will be restarted in ${Math.floor(appLoad.restartTimeout/1e3)} seconds.`)+appLoad.btnCancelRestart))}))}